Alright, first of all, I don't know if you made new groups.

Click on 'admin' > Member Groups > Create New group. Fill in a group name, then is the group staff or not? Mostly it's just no. If you want the group to have a colour, you can add a hex code in there. Also I think 'limited powers' should be on 'no' when the group isn't staff, moderator or something along those lines.

Then click on continue, then you get a whole list of abilities. If you want to create a normal member group, keep all those abilities on 'No'. If you create moderators, staff, co-admins, global moderators etc you can decide yourself which powers to give them.

Alright, now to get members into the right member group. Click on a members name and go to 'Modify Profile', scroll down to 'Admin Functions'. The first dropdown box is where you can select the member group. Select a member group, click on modify profile, and the member is in the new usergroup you selected.
